We also run this sort of HP and oracle stuff and thankfully haven't hit this problem. However I notice that orasrv on HP supports some less well known options. In your circumstances I would try running orasrv with the 'forkon' option. This should create a separate orasrv process to handle each login and hopefully only the child will lock up and not the server. Maybe it could even fix it :-)
